How to read my Bible more
How I did it: Started with 2 minutes a day. Then 5. Then 10. Then 30.
Started fitting it into my life rather than figuring out how to make my life fit into it (like instead of getting up earlier I now read on the bus some days if I'm really busy. Mostly I just read at night because that's when I'm not concentrating on other things & can really get into it.)
Got a "Read The Bible In 1 Yr." Devotional Bible & it helps immensely.
Am currently reading the bible in a year by only reading 3 chapters a day. Nice to switch it up a bit.
Lessons & tips: If you need a schedule, write one. Devotional books help & save time one deciding where & what to read. Also help you dig deeper. Break it up into smaller bits at first so you don't get overwhelmed.
Switch it up!! I get bored...I have lots of different references so I'm always getting something new.
It takes 6 weeks to make a new habit & break an old habit. KEEP AT IT!! When you skip; start over again from scratch...otherwise all the skipping adds up & you think you failed; when that's just a lie. :)
